Job Description

We are seeking an experienced support worker to join our team in Campbelltown.

This is a dynamic and innovative opportunity to work with individuals living with severe and persistent mental health conditions, often combined with other complexities such as substance use, trauma, or cognitive impairment.

  • Provide individualised, trauma-informed support in line with clients' care and recovery plans
  • De-escalate behaviours of concern and respond effectively in crisis situations
  • Assist with daily living activities, community participation, and skill development
  • Support clients in managing mental health symptoms, medication adherence, and health appointments
  • Foster meaningful relationships and promote social and emotional well-being

The ideal candidate will have a strong understanding of recovery-based, person-centred, and trauma-informed care principles. They will also possess exceptional communication, conflict resolution, and risk management skills, as well as the ability to work independently and as part of a multidisciplinary team.

Required Skills and Qualifications
  • Minimum 5 years' experience working in mental health or disability support, with a focus on complex client needs
  • Proven experience supporting individuals with dual diagnosis, trauma history, or psychosocial disabilities
  • Strong understanding of recovery-based, person-centred, and trauma-informed care principles
  • Exceptional communication, conflict resolution, and risk management skills
